ALEXANDRIA, Va., Feb. 24 -- United States Patent no. 12,559,232, issued on Feb. 24, was assigned to Ampaire Inc. (Hawthorne, Calif.).
"Electric vertical takeoff and landing aircraft" was invented by Damon Vander Lind (Hayward, Calif.).
According to the abstract* released by the U.S. Patent & Trademark Office: "An electric vertical takeoff and landing (EVTOL) aircraft is disclosed. In some aspects, the aircraft comprises a main wing, an empennage, two lift propulsors, and two lift/thrust propulsors each mounted on a tilt axis."
The patent was filed on May 31, 2022, under Application No. 17/828,760.
